It was overwhelming. All five of his senses kicked up to hyperdrive. The smell of smoke, the heat of the flames licking at his ankles, the brightness of the fire, the taste of ash on his tongue… the screams of his friend. It was all too much.
His eyes stung with tears as the smoke continued to attack his lungs forcing a cough from within him. The whole upstairs of the house was engulfed in flames and all he could do was stand and listen to the pained wails of his friend. His legs stung as his trousers stuck to his melted skin. He had tried desperately to get up the stairs, to save his friend. To save the love of his life.
Everything began to blur together once the wails of pain stopped. He hadn't noticed the firefighters or the paramedic sitting him down in the back of the ambulance or the pain from his legs as the paramedic peeled away his trousers. He was stuck, lost in his own mind.
It took days for him to regain consciousness, when the realisation that his best friend was truly gone fully dawned on him. He spent that day in bed.
It wasn't long till the funeral. It was cold and thundering outside - how ironic - everyone arriving dressed in black and soaked from head to toe. As he passed Rodolfos mother they shared a pained smile, Alejandro holding back tears and sharing his condolences. He shouldn't be here. He didn't deserve to be here. He was the reason that sweet woman who'd let Alejandro into her home countless times and held him when he had an argument with his parents was now sitting sobbing on her knees grieving for her son. He was the reason why Rodolfo was dead. He had sent him into that house fully aware of the dangers that lay before him.
Alejandro took a breath turning towards the closed casket where the body of his best friend lay. Rodolfos mother had wanted an open casket funeral but was told that would not be possible as her son's body was so badly burnt there wasn't much left of him and would be completely unrecognisable.
He wasn't sure how long he had stood there staring at the casket before him until a hand lay on his forearm. It was Rodolfos mother. She looked up at him sharing a once again pained smile and leant against him. She bought a tissue up to her eye and squeezed Alejandro's arm.
“ This isn't your fault, you know. “ she whispered.
Alejandro looked down towards her.
“ What? “ He breathed.
“ It's not your fault he's gone Alejandro. He knew the risks as you did. You can't go blaming yourself. He's safer now. At peace… I hope. “
All Alejandro could do was stare at the woman who'd now turned her gaze towards the casket. Tears began to fall at the words she had spoken. The screams of agony haunted him. He'd do anything to turn back time and go into that house instead of sending Rodolfo in. He wished he wasn't gone. He wished he told Rodolfo how he'd actually felt.
The rain still fell, hammering against the umbrella he held above him and Rudys mother. The casket lowered into the ground as everyone stood in silence. This was it.
Alejandro's stomach sank. Rudy was truly gone. Not coming back. He'd never see that smile ever again, hear that laugh after he'd told an awful joke… never get to hold him again. He was Gone.
